The word "pensioners" sounds like a UK term. In the US, low-income households can get heating assistance. Your gas and/or electric company can help. Many states, especially in eastern US, have "Community Action Agencies" that can also help. In Illinois and Kentucky, for example, low-income households can get help with heating bills AND with improvements to their homes to increase heating efficiency (known as "weatherization" in the US).
